What is remote mathematical modeling?

Remote mathematical modeling involves using mathematical equations and computational methods to represent real-world systems or processes, all while working from a location outside of a traditional office environment. Professionals in this field use tools like MATLAB, Python, or R to develop and analyze models for industries such as finance, engineering, healthcare, and environmental science. The remote aspect allows for flexible collaboration with teams worldwide through digital communication platforms. This role typically requires strong analytical skills, problem-solving abilities, and proficiency in mathematical software.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ote mathematical modeler?

To thrive as a Remote Mathematical Modeler, you need a strong background in mathematics, statistics, and computational modeling, typically supported by a relevant degree such as mathematics, engineering, or physics. Proficiency with technical tools like MATLAB, R, Python, and specialized modeling software, as well as experience with data analysis and simulation platforms, is essential. Strong problem-solving, analytical thinking, and effective written communication skills set top performers apart in this role. These skills are crucial for developing accurate models, interpreting complex data remotely, and delivering clear insights to clients or stakeholders.

What are some common challenges faced by remote mathematical modelers, and how can they be addressed?

Remote mathematical modelers often encounter challenges such as limited real-time collaboration with colleagues, potential miscommunication regarding model requirements, and managing complex data sets independently. These can be addressed by utilizing collaborative tools like shared code repositories, regular virtual meetings, and clear documentation practices. Additionally, proactively seeking feedback and maintaining open channels of communication with stakeholders can help ensure alignment and successful project outcomes.
